Kyle Bryant Kyle Bryant Friedreich’s Ataxia Research Alliance (FARA)

One of the families in our community had an event annually for 10 years that was a 3 day hangout session on a farm for FA families. People camped out, and there were all kinds of activities, such as swimming, fishing, yoga, tie-dying, crafts, fireworks, and all-you-can-eat ice cream. At this event, people with Friedreich’s ataxia (FA) never felt out of place, and we were all able to be together without the awkwardness that can be present around people who might not understand the experience of FA.

My Rare Moment is anytime I get to be with my people.

I had such a fulfilling experience visiting my members of Congress as part of Rare Disease Week on Capitol Hill. My fellow advocates and I raised our voices to encourage their support of policies that benefit rare disease patients. Hearing everyone’s stories was so inspiring.

We are proud to support and bring awareness to Triple Negative Breast Cancer Day which was yesterday, March 3rd. Individuals in the United States have a 1 in 8 chance of developing breast cancer and TNBC accounts for 10-25% of those breast cancers. Me and many others at Worldwide are excited to take part in the many events occurring throughout March that bring awareness to this disease.
